receiver:
The body of the weapon in which most, if not all, the parts issue into. The receiver is also the ONLY part of the weapon that the BATFE requires paperwork on.

For example. I built an AK, AR, FAL, and HK 51. All of which require a receiver to function. The receivers are the only part thAT i HAD TO FILE PAPERWORK ON. I bought all the other parts on my own, and with no paperwork.

Basically, the receiver is how the government tracks the sale of a weapon, that way you dont have to fill out paperwork for every little part, just one.
